Bagaimana Zero-Knowledge Proofs (ZKP) Mengubah Permainan untuk Masa Depan Privasi dalam Blockchain

ZKP memberikan privasi blockchain dengan memverifikasi data tanpa mengungkapkannya. Dengan menggunakan alat seperti zk-SNARKs, mereka memungkinkan DeFi, pemungutan suara, dan identitas yang bersifat privat, menyeimbangkan transparansi dengan biaya teknis yang tinggi.

Pengantar
Privasi kini adalah kebutuhan; bukan lagi bonus. Ketika buku besar blockchain terlihat jelas, ada masalah mendasar bagi pengguna dan bisnis: bagaimana menjaga informasi pribadi tetap aman di sistem publik?
ZKP, atau Zero-Knowledge Proofs (Pembuktian Tanpa Pengetahuan), adalah cara untuk membuktikan sesuatu itu benar tanpa mengungkapkan alasannya.
Bayangkan Anda bisa membuktikan siapa diri Anda, tanpa menunjukkan paspor Anda. Kedengarannya seperti sihir, bukan? Sebenarnya, ini adalah matematika, lebih tepatnya, kriptografi.
Artikel ini akan menjelaskan, secara berurutan, cara kerja ZKP, mengapa hal itu penting untuk privasi di blockchain, dan bagaimana ZKP memungkinkan langkah selanjutnya untuk membangun kepercayaan dalam ekonomi digital.
Apa Arti Privasi dalam Blockchain
Blockchain didasarkan pada gagasan keterbukaan, dan keterbukaan itu menghasilkan kepercayaan karena Anda dapat melihat semuanya secara publik. Sisi buruk dari keterbukaan adalah Anda dapat melihat setiap transaksi, setiap alamat, dan setiap saldo.
Bagi individu, itu berarti privasi keuangan; bagi organisasi, itu berarti apakah rahasia dagang mereka tetap rahasia, apakah karyawan mereka berperilaku baik, atau apakah data konsumen mereka bersifat pribadi.
Jadi pertanyaannya adalah, apakah keterbukaan mungkin tanpa mengorbankan privasi? ZKP menyediakan cara cerdas untuk dapat menunjukkan validitas tanpa merilis data yang biasanya Anda andalkan untuk validitas.
Apa Itu ZKP, atau Zero-Knowledge Proofs?
Ketika satu pihak (pembukti) meyakinkan pihak lain (pemverifikasi) bahwa mereka mengetahui sebuah rahasia, itu disebut Zero-Knowledge Proof (ZKP). Anda bisa membuat kotak di depan saya dan membukanya untuk menunjukkan bahwa Anda memiliki kunci, tetapi Anda tidak perlu menunjukkan kunci itu kepada saya.
Contoh: "Teman Buta Warna"
Bayangkan teman Anda yang buta warna menginginkan bukti bahwa Anda dapat membedakan kelereng merah dari yang hijau. Anda menunjukkan kedua kelereng, meletakkannya di belakang punggung Anda, menukarnya, dan bertanya mana yang mana.
Teman Anda memahami bahwa Anda pasti dapat memisahkan kelereng merah dan hijau jika Anda terus-menerus mendapatkan jawaban yang benar meskipun mereka tidak tahu warna apa yang Anda tunjukkan.
Itulah esensi ZKP: pembuktian tanpa menunjukkan.
Cara Kerja ZKP
ZKP dapat dipecah menjadi tiga langkah utama untuk membantu mengatur proses berpikir:
“Sihir” ini berasal dari kriptografi, menggunakan teka-teki matematika yang kompleks untuk memverifikasi bahwa pemverifikasi hanya diyakinkan dengan aman akan kebenaran dan tidak memiliki kesempatan untuk menebak.
Dalam blockchain, dengan kontrak pintar, pembuktian tersebut terjadi secara otomatis. Kontrak pintar, node, atau elemen lain tidak "melihat" data pribadi atau informasi potensial lainnya secara real-time.
Jenis Utama ZKP
Pembuktian Interaktif
Ini ditandai dengan pembukti dan pemverifikasi yang berkomunikasi satu sama lain.
Pembuktian Non-Interaktif
Ini berarti bahwa hanya bukti yang diperlukan, dan tidak ada komunikasi yang terjadi. Sangat baik untuk otomatisasi menggunakan blockchain.
ZKP dalam Blockchain
Meskipun blockchain berfungsi dengan sangat baik dalam model yang terbuka dan transparan, tidak setiap orang ingin dunia mengetahui apa yang mereka lakukan dengan uang mereka. ZKP membantu mengisi kesenjangan itu dengan menjaga informasi pengguna tetap pribadi di buku besar publik.
Kasus Penggunaan
Pemungutan Suara Pribadi
Pemilihan di blockchain dapat bersifat terbuka dan dapat diverifikasi, sekaligus menjaga kerahasiaan isi setiap suara. ZKP berarti hanya suara yang sah yang dihitung—tanpa mengungkapkan siapa memilih siapa. Ini membuat DAO, koperasi, dan pemilihan nasional menjadi aman dan anonim.
Verifikasi Identitas Terdesentralisasi
Di Web3, pengguna sering kali harus membuktikan kelayakan mereka. Misalnya, mereka perlu membuktikan bahwa mereka berusia di atas 18 tahun atau memiliki kredensial tertentu. ZKP memungkinkan mereka untuk membuktikan bahwa mereka memenuhi syarat tanpa membagikan data dasar, yang dapat merevolusi proses orientasi DeFi dan KYC.
Transaksi Pribadi
Zcash dan Aztec menggunakan ZKP untuk berbagi secara pribadi, misalnya, pengirim, penerima, dan jumlah yang ditransaksikan disembunyikan, tetapi transaksi itu sendiri masih dapat dibuktikan. Ini seperti menggunakan blockchain dengan privasi tingkat bank.
Contoh ZKP di Dunia Nyata
Protokol Aztec Ethereum
Aztec adalah sistem pembayaran yang mengutamakan privasi, diluncurkan pada tahun 2022, yang menggunakan ZKP untuk mengenkripsi data transaksi, sekaligus memungkinkan pembayaran divalidasi—yang semuanya memungkinkan privasi bagi pengguna Ethereum saat melakukan aktivitas sehari-hari dengan mata uang kripto.
Zcash
Apakah ada yang memperkenalkan zk-SNARKs (atau zero-knowledge proofs) sebelum Zcash? Zcash memungkinkan pengguna untuk melakukan transaksi transparan atau terlindungi.
Polygon zkEVM
Alat terbaru dalam menggabungkan zk-rollups dengan kompatibilitas Ethereum. Seperti yang disebutkan sebelumnya, kita dapat melakukan skalasi sambil menjaga informasi tetap pribadi—ini adalah lompatan besar menuju adopsi ZK secara mainstream.
Namun untuk menjadi pribadi membutuhkan tingkat akuntabilitas, dan pihak berwenang menghadapi dilema nyata dalam mencari cara melacak transaksi yang tidak dapat mereka lihat.
Masa Depan ZKP
Kekuatan Zero-knowledge proofs jauh melampaui pembayaran.
Pikirkan kontrak pintar yang sepenuhnya pribadi, di mana logika dan data disembunyikan, tetapi hasil akhirnya terbukti benar.
Kita dapat membayangkan penggunaan ZKP untuk:
Seiring teknologi terus berkembang, kita kemungkinan akan melihat seluruh ekosistem aplikasi terdesentralisasi yang nirkepercayaan dan pribadi.
Tantangan di Depan
ZKP jelas menunjukkan potensi, tetapi ada tantangan signifikan.
- Biaya komputasi tinggi: Tindakan membangun bukti dapat membutuhkan sumber daya yang sangat besar.
- Skalabilitas: Infrastruktur saat ini tidak dapat melakukan skalasi untuk melakukan operasi besar.
- Ketidakpastian regulasi: Semua regulator ingin melihat kumpulan data tetapi juga ingin dapat menjaga data tetap pribadi.
Seluruh industri berfokus untuk membuat bukti lebih cepat dan lebih murah untuk dibuat, baik itu melalui akselerasi perangkat keras atau metode kriptografi hibrida.
Menemukan Keseimbangan Antara Privasi dan Keterbukaan
Ini semua tentang keseimbangan dan menyempurnakan transparansi dengan ZKP.
ZKP tidak menyembunyikan semuanya; mereka hanya mengungkapkan apa yang diperlukan. Kepercayaan didasarkan pada matematika, bukan kemampuan dilihat.
Ini bisa mengubah cara kita memahami privasi digital untuk perbankan, pemerintah, dan kepemilikan data.
Jalan Menuju Penggunaan Luas
Agar ZKP menjadi mainstream, kita membutuhkan beberapa komponen krusial:
Pada akhirnya, tantangannya lebih dari sekadar kriptografi, tetapi juga pemahaman dan penerimaan komunitas terhadap privasi blockchain.
Kesimpulan
Zero-Knowledge Proofs mengubah makna privasi dalam teknologi blockchain.
Mereka memungkinkan kepercayaan tanpa mengungkapkan data itu sendiri, menawarkan individu dan perusahaan kemampuan untuk berinteraksi dengan percaya di ekosistem terdesentralisasi.
Seiring teknologi ZK terus berkembang, itu akan mengubah cara kita mempercayai di dunia digital, memungkinkan privasi dan transparansi untuk hidup berdampingan.
Artikel ini dikontribusikan oleh penulis eksternal: Razel Jade Hijastro.
Disclaimer: Konten yang dibuat oleh LBank Creators mewakili perspektif pribadi mereka. LBank tidak mendukung konten apa pun di halaman ini. Pembaca harus melakukan penelitian mereka sendiri sebelum mengambil tindakan apa pun terkait perusahaan dan bertanggung jawab penuh atas keputusan mereka, dan artikel ini tidak dapat dianggap sebagai saran investasi.






